
Parking at Tampa International Airport can vary in cost depending on the duration and type of parking chosen. For short-term parking, rates start at $2 per hour, with a daily maximum of $14. Long-term parking is more economical for extended stays, priced at $10 per day. Additionally, there's an option for valet parking at $25 per day, which includes gratuity. For those needing to park for an extended period, the airport offers a weekly rate of $60. It's important to note that these rates are subject to change, and it's advisable to check the airport's official website for the most current pricing information. Furthermore, various payment methods are accepted, including credit cards and mobile payments, providing convenience for travelers.

Payment Methods: Accepted forms of payment for parking at Tampa Airport, including cash, credit cards, and mobile payments
Tampa Airport offers a variety of payment methods for parking, ensuring convenience for travelers. One of the most traditional forms of payment accepted is cash. There are attended parking lots where you can pay with cash upon entry or exit. However, it's important to note that some unattended lots may not accept cash, so it's advisable to check the specific lot's payment options beforehand.
Credit cards are another widely accepted form of payment at Tampa Airport parking facilities. All major credit cards, including Visa, MasterCard, American Express, and Discover, are typically accepted at both attended and unattended parking lots. When using a credit card, you may be required to insert the card into a payment machine or use a contactless payment option if available.
In addition to cash and credit cards, Tampa Airport also supports mobile payments for parking. This can include services like Apple Pay, Google Pay, or Samsung Pay, depending on the specific parking lot and its payment system. Mobile payments offer a quick and convenient way to pay for parking without the need to carry cash or a physical credit card.
Some parking lots at Tampa Airport may also offer the option to pay through a mobile app specific to the parking service provider. These apps often allow you to pay for parking remotely, receive notifications when your parking time is about to expire, and even extend your parking time without having to return to the lot.
It's worth noting that while these payment methods are generally accepted, there may be exceptions depending on the specific parking lot or service provider. Therefore, it's always a good idea to check the payment options for your chosen parking facility before your trip to avoid any potential issues.
